I am doing that right now. Inner and outer tie rod ends, upper and lower ball joints, pitman arm and idler arm, and new springs. I'm replacing it all with Moog parts. Just the parts and alignment, doing all the work myself except the alignment, is costing me about $550.

I could have saved myself a little money and bought cheaper parts from Auto Zone or a kit from performance suspension, but I want rubber parts, and I want good parts.

I assume you mean you will keep the control arms and replace the bushings in them. I can't figure out why you would replace the control arms or studs...
